Output 191f757006fa37be10284e7ae91b24926ff546141ed7eee04dfaaedff5373189:7

value
3550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1730a4d26c187c4c2e4a417f47a75d47ec9561de OP_EQUAL
address
33odjnhqDzz95ij5x7he83yNaKCkhbmHkJ
transaction
191f757006fa37be10284e7ae91b24926ff546141ed7eee04dfaaedff5373189
spent
true